Charitable objects

THE PROVISION AND MAINTENANCE OF A VILLAGE HALL FOR THE USE OF THE INHABITANTS OF LLANISHEN TRELLECK GRANGE AND LLANFIHANGEL TOR-Y-MYNYDD, WITHOUT DISTINCTION OF POLITICAL, RELIGIOUS OR OTHER OPINIONS, INCLUDING USE FOR MEETINGS, LECTURES AND CLASSES, AND FOR OTHER FORMS OF RECREATION AND LEISURE-TIME OCCUPATION, WITH THE OBJECT OF IMPROVING THE CONDITIONS OF LIFE FOR THE SAID INHABITANTS.

Governing document: SCHEME OF 24 JANUARY 1979. AS AMENDED ON 26 MARCH 2009.
